Study of cluster structures of excited states for the light nuclei He, Li and Be in three-body photodisintegration processes. Application for the excited states of the 6He* nucleus

Abstract

The method used to investigate the cluster structures of excited states for the light nuclei He, Li and Be in three-body photodisintegration processes is described. As an application we present the experimental program on the Yerevan synchrotron for the photodisintegration of 7Li target, the production and decay of the 6He isotope and the study of the two-cluster (tritons) structures of excited states. In particular, the properties of the detectors used in the setup, as well as the precision and simulation of the measured values are presented.
